SPORTING INTELLIGENCE.

. T. Lynch, who was selected to represent ao in the, football match agaipat South: next Saturday, being unable to get W. Lang has been chosen in hie place. A general. meeting of the Green Island Club will be held in the Foresters Hall on Wednesday evening, the 9th inst. Winners at the recent meeting may receive payment pt the Green Island Hotel. It has transpired that Mr O'Biien purchased Freeman on behalf of T. Corrigan, the well-known cross-country rider. The following are the latest betting quotationsCaulfield Cop; 100 to 8 agst jDongebah, 100 to 5, each Teketun, Sir William, Paris, and..Gladstone, 100 to 4 each Mirnee and Malvolio. Melbourns Cup; 100 to 7 each agst Megaphone, Vengeance, and Melos, 100 to 5 each Paris, Carbine, Malvolio, and Correze, 100 to 4 Wbakawai.

RANDWICK TRAINING NOTES. [By Electric Telegraph. —Copyright, ] [Per Fuss Association.! SYDNEY, September i. (Received September 8,1891, at 1.60 p.m.) o»ing to the postponement of Tattenall’s meeting from last Saturday to Saturday of this week, not mnfeh work hai been done for the Metropolitan Stakes. To-day at Randwick Jack was sent a good working gallop over a mile; Scots Grey and S Iver Knight together compassed once roond, the former having all the best of it; Kilmore, who is improving daily j put in serviceable work ; and Sir William bad very little trouble In disposing of E.K. in a strongly run mile. Mantilla rattled over a mile and a-qnarter in good form.
